Age | Commit message (Collapse) | Author | |
---|---|---|---|
2020-03-03 | benchmark gitlab.com/gitlab-org/gitlab-pages/internal/source/diskcherry-pick-1e9f978d | Alessio Caiazza | |
2020-03-03 | Merge branch 'master' into 'master' | Alessio Caiazza | |
dragonfly bsd support by updating godirwalk to v1.14.0 Closes #316 See merge request gitlab-org/gitlab-pages!215 (cherry picked from commit 1e9f978d74ae0e1d536f1984635021b368802ccb) 6df90126 dragonfly bsd support by updating godirwalk to v1.14.0 | |||
2020-03-03 | Run benchstats on CI | Alessio Caiazza | |
2020-02-28 | Merge branch 'backstage/gb/add-ensure-certs-benchmark' into 'master' | Alessio Caiazza | |
Add benchmark for throughput on ensuring domain certs See merge request gitlab-org/gitlab-pages!251 | |||
2020-02-28 | Merge branch 'feature/gb/serverless-serving-enable' into 'master' | Alessio Caiazza | |
Enable serverless serving See merge request gitlab-org/gitlab-pages!232 | |||
2020-02-28 | Add benchmark for throughput on ensuring domain certs | Grzegorz Bizon | |
2020-02-28 | Avoid implicit delegation in disk serving | Grzegorz Bizon | |
2020-02-27 | Improve comments and code readability | Grzegorz Bizon | |
2020-02-27 | Merge branch 'race-test' into 'master'355-tech-evaluation-serve-pages-from-object-storage | Vladimir Shushlin | |
Run go test -race in CI See merge request gitlab-org/gitlab-pages!246 | |||
2020-02-26 | Skip racy test | Alessio Caiazza | |
2020-02-26 | Fix data race on cache.client struct | Alessio Caiazza | |
2020-02-26 | Run go test -race in CI | Alessio Caiazza | |
2020-02-24 | Log an error when a serving can not be fabricated | Grzegorz Bizon | |
2020-02-24 | Move serving and lookup path factory to source package | Grzegorz Bizon | |
2020-02-24 | Improve code quality and add a few missing comments | Grzegorz Bizon | |
2020-02-20 | Merge branch 'remove-ctx-https-key' into 'master' | Alessio Caiazza | |
Remove ctxHTTPSKey from the context completely Closes #219 See merge request gitlab-org/gitlab-pages!245 | |||
2020-02-19 | Remove request.WithHTTPSFlag and set directly in tests | Jaime Martinez | |
2020-02-18 | Fix go imports in factory lookup_path.go file | Grzegorz Bizon | |
2020-02-18 | Simplify serverless serving and add a few tests | Grzegorz Bizon | |
2020-02-18 | Add tests for gitlab source lookup path factory | Grzegorz Bizon | |
2020-02-18 | Enable serverless domains source | Grzegorz Bizon | |
2020-02-18 | Ensure that we not do return nil serving.Request | Grzegorz Bizon | |
2020-02-18 | Merge branch 'master' into feature/gb/serverless-serving-enable | Grzegorz Bizon | |
* master: 1.16.0 Release Fix broken CI pipeline badge | |||
2020-02-18 | Merge branch '352-1-16-0-release' into 'master'v1.16.0 | Alessio Caiazza | |
1.16.0 Release See merge request gitlab-org/gitlab-pages!243 | |||
2020-02-18 | 1.16.0 Release | Vladimir Shushlin | |
2020-02-17 | Remove ctxHTTPSKey from the context completely | Jaime Martinez | |
2020-02-12 | Merge branch 'fix-broken-pipeline-badge' into 'master' | Vladimir Shushlin | |
Fix broken CI pipeline badge See merge request gitlab-org/gitlab-pages!241 | |||
2020-02-12 | Fix broken CI pipeline badge | Takuya Noguchi | |
Signed-off-by: Takuya Noguchi <takninnovationresearch@gmail.com> | |||
2020-02-12 | Merge branch 'master' into feature/gb/serverless-serving-enable | Grzegorz Bizon | |
* master: Add prometheus metrics for GitLab API client Fix benchmarks Freeze tools version Add acceptance test for serverless metrics Update documentation on using Gorilla ProxyHeaders use gorilla/handlers.ProxyHeaders to get the X-Forwarded-* headers and set them in the appropriate http.Request fields Apply suggestion to metrics/metrics.go Add serverless serving metrics Conflicts: internal/serving/serverless/serverless.go | |||
2020-02-12 | Make it possible to fabricate a serverless serving | Grzegorz Bizon | |
2020-02-12 | Add GitLab API definition for serverless serving | Grzegorz Bizon | |
2020-02-11 | Memoize disk serving on a package level | Grzegorz Bizon | |
2020-02-11 | Make it possible to fabricate serving per request | Grzegorz Bizon | |
2020-02-11 | Merge branch '267-track-api-calls' into 'master' | Alessio Caiazza | |
Provide a way to track and measure API calls Closes #267 See merge request gitlab-org/gitlab-pages!229 | |||
2020-02-11 | Add prometheus metrics for GitLab API client | Jaime Martinez | |
Refactor metrics initialization removing init function from the metrics package. | |||
2020-02-07 | Rename lookup variable in domain struct function | Grzegorz Bizon | |
2020-02-05 | Merge branch '348-update-readme-proxy-headers' into 'master' | Alessio Caiazza | |
Update documentation on using Gorilla ProxyHeaders Closes #348 See merge request gitlab-org/gitlab-pages!233 | |||
2020-02-05 | Merge branch 'fix-benchmarks' into 'master' | Vladimir Shushlin | |
Fix benchmarks See merge request gitlab-org/gitlab-pages!238 | |||
2020-02-05 | Fix benchmarks | Alessio Caiazza | |
Go benchmarks must loop over b.N | |||
2020-02-05 | Add support for per-lookup-path domain serving | Grzegorz Bizon | |
2020-02-05 | Merge branch 'fix-deps' into 'master' | Vladimir Shushlin | |
Freeze tools version See merge request gitlab-org/gitlab-pages!235 | |||
2020-02-05 | Freeze tools version | Alessio Caiazza | |
2020-02-05 | Merge branch 'feature/gb/add-serveress-metrics' into 'master' | Vladimir Shushlin | |
Add serverless serving metrics Closes #346 See merge request gitlab-org/gitlab-pages!231 | |||
2020-02-05 | Add acceptance test for serverless metrics | Grzegorz Bizon | |
2020-02-04 | Update documentation on using Gorilla ProxyHeaders | Jaime Martinez | |
2020-02-03 | Merge branch '219-use-proxy-headers-https' into 'master' | Alessio Caiazza | |
Set the r.URL.Scheme via middleware and log mismatches with the https flag in the context See merge request gitlab-org/gitlab-pages!225 | |||
2020-02-03 | use gorilla/handlers.ProxyHeaders to get the X-Forwarded-* headers and set ↵ | Jaime Martinez | |
them in the appropriate http.Request fields | |||
2020-02-03 | Apply suggestion to metrics/metrics.go | Grzegorz Bizon | |
2020-02-03 | Add serverless serving metrics | Grzegorz Bizon | |
This adds: - serverless invocations counter - serverless request latency histogram | |||
2020-01-31 | Merge branch 'feature/gb/add-serverless-serving' into 'master' | Vladimir Shushlin | |
Add a new serverless serving Closes #325 See merge request gitlab-org/gitlab-pages!216 |